What to Expect
Work in hospitality and tourism in the Netherlands involves customer interaction, ensuring guest satisfaction, and maintaining high standards of service. Shifts often include evenings, weekends, and holidays, especially during peak seasons. Physical demands may include standing for long hours, moving luggage, or serving in busy settings. Working hours generally range from 20 to 40 hours per week, with the possibility of overtime during busy times. The work environment is multicultural, with colleagues and customers from all over the world. Benefits typically include paid leave, holiday pay, and sometimes discounts at partner establishments.
Requirements
Most employers in the hospitality sector in Schijndel look for candidates aged 21 and above with good English or Dutch language skills. Experience is beneficial but not always necessary – many roles provide on-the-job training. Important documents include a valid ID, BSN number (Dutch citizen service number), and proof of right to work in the Netherlands. Good communication skills, a positive attitude, and ability to work under pressure are valued qualities. Knowledge of additional languages like Polish or Romanian can be an advantage.
Salary & Benefits
In 2026, the minimum wage for workers aged 21+ in the Netherlands is €14.71 per hour. Hospitality roles typically pay between €15.00 and €20.00 per hour, depending on experience and the specific job. Tips and bonuses may supplement income, especially in high-end establishments. Many employers also offer benefits such as travel allowances, training opportunities, and paid leave. Full-time roles may provide health insurance coverage as part of your employment package, which is mandatory in the Netherlands and essential for your well-being.
